Unfulfilled Promises. by Respect55(m): 12:43pm On Sep 06, 2020
In the olden days, prophetic utterances were final and apt. Once it is professed, it would be regarded as having happened already. But if his words failed, he wouldn't be spared(Deut. 18:22). But it's not the same in our modern day Christianity.

There is this boy in my local Assembly who deals on phone accessories. 2 years ago, a church programme was organized and an outside speaker took charge. He called this guy's name and told him everything about him including what he does for a living.

A prophetic utterance was made on him that by that time next year (that was in 2018 meaning by 2019) money would worship him as his name would be heard all over the nation.

Fastfoward to two years and this boy is still pushing his wares on wheel barrow.

Can someone enlighten me on this.
